Building on strong foundations
NHS England's recent communication to healthcare leaders emphasises the remarkable progress achieved in the first half of 2025/26, moving from a predicted £6 billion deficit to a balanced financial position whilst simultaneously improving waiting times across elective, cancer, and emergency care services. This achievement represents a significant milestone in healthcare operational management and demonstrates the power of strategic leadership combined with effective workforce deployment.
The focus on maintaining this momentum through the second half of the year highlights the critical importance of robust workforce management systems and the need for organisations to have flexible, responsive solutions that can adapt to changing demands and pressures.
